My 2001 SLR has done 8 K miles. 4 track days and 8 sprints.

Today it has gone in for replacement prop shaft and drive shaft oil seals to the diff,(diff oil everywhere) new front discs (warped, conciderably worse when hot ) and new rear anti roll bar bushes.(I can waggle the ARB by hand)

Is this normal, or am I doing something very wrong ?

I too have a 2001 SL with 13K on the clock. I have had only one of those problems - the front disks being warped. I have however had: a new altenator @ 500 miles, a new clutch cable @ 8K, a new idicator & high and low beam switches and three new radiator switches 🙆🏻.

My 97 HPC has done a bit more work than that and the only think like that I have replaced is the lower wishbone rose joints, the top links and the track rod ends.

 

All shafts/bushes/clutch cable/engine mounts etc are original and in good health.

 

Hmmm, i wonder if the suppliers for some of these bits has changed on newer cars?
